Automated Color Sorting for Optimal Quality Control

In today's dynamic manufacturing landscape, ensuring optimal quality control is paramount to achieving customer satisfaction and brand reputation. Color consistency plays a vital role in many industries, impact product aesthetics and consumer perception. Automated color sorting systems have emerged as a powerful solution to mitigate this challenge by utilizing advanced imaging and algorithm to precisely classify items based on their color characteristics.

These sophisticated systems employ high-resolution cameras and sophisticated algorithms to identify minute color variations. By evaluating the captured information against predefined standards, the system can efficiently categorize items into distinct color categories. This streamlining process ensures that only products meeting the desired color specifications proceed through the manufacturing pipeline.

Moreover, automated color sorting systems offer a range of perks over manual inspection methods. They provide superior accuracy, consistency, and speed, reducing human error and labor costs. The ability to sort items in real-time allows for immediate analysis, enabling manufacturers to immediately address any quality control issues.

Precision Rice Grading with Advanced Optical Sorters

In the dynamic world of rice production, efficiency is paramount. Contemporary optical sorters have revolutionized rice grading by enabling precise identification of rice grains based on physical characteristics. These sophisticated systems employ high-resolution cameras and advanced software to analyze individual grains, detecting defects such as size variations. Consequently, optical sorters deliver a level of accuracy exceeding traditional conventional approaches. This results in higher quality rice, boosting farmer profitability.

  • Additionally, optical sorters can simultaneously sort rice based on other factors such as shade and surface appearance.
  • Such adaptability makes them essential for satisfying the growing requirements of the global rice market.

Optimizing Tea Excellence with Color Sorting Technology

In the realm of the tea industry, quality is paramount. Consumers demand premium teas known for their vibrant flavors and desirable appearances. Color sorting technology, a advanced process, has emerged as a crucial tool in enhancing tea quality by meticulously selecting tea leaves based on their shade. This precision ensures that only the best leaves are utilized in the final blend, resulting in a uniform and superior tea experience.
